Electropolishing for professional jewellery production

Electropolishing is an advanced surface finishing process that is increasingly used in professional jewellery workshops. The method enables smoothing and high-gloss polishing of metal surfaces through a controlled electrolytic process, where microscopic surface irregularities are removed without mechanical impact.

What is electropolishing?

Electropolishing is an electrolytic process in which the workpiece is immersed in a specially developed electrolyte and exposed to electrical current. The result is a controlled smoothing of the surface, producing a smooth, bright and uniform finish – without altering the shape or fine details.

For goldsmiths and jewellery designers, this means:

  • Reduced manual polishing work
  • Consistent and reproducible results
  • Gentle processing of delicate items
  • The ability to polish internal contours and hard-to-reach areas

Electropolishing is particularly well suited for gold alloys, white gold, palladium white gold, silver and brass – for both cast and 3D-printed jewellery.

Advanced electropolishing machines for jewellery from OTEC

Our range includes OTEC EF-Nova and EF-Smart S+ – two electropolishing machines representing the latest advancements in the technology.

EF-Nova is a powerful and user-friendly machine that efficiently polishes red, yellow and white gold as well as silver and brass. With short processing times of typically 10–30 minutes and the capacity to process multiple rings at once, it is ideal for daily production. Polishing and fine polishing are combined in a single process, while predefined programs ensure consistent quality.

EF-Smart S+ is designed for professionals working with complex jewellery, fine details and stone-set pieces. The electrolytic process is particularly gentle, ensuring high-gloss polishing without rounding prongs or risking damage to stones. The machine supports multi-step programs and provides full control over voltage, rotation and processing time, making it suitable for both single-piece production and small series.

Safe electropolishing and a better working environment

Modern electropolishing is not only about surface finish, but also about the working environment. OTEC’s electropolishing machines use electrolyte solutions free from acid and cyanide, contributing to a safer and more comfortable workshop environment.

When does electropolishing add the most value in jewellery production?

Electropolishing is particularly relevant if you:

  • Work with complex jewellery and fine details
  • Require consistent results in repeated production
  • Want to reduce time spent on manual finishing
  • Produce both cast and 3D-printed pieces
  • Focus on ergonomics and a better working environment

Many professionals use electropolishing as a fixed part of their production workflow – either as a final finish or as preparation before manual polishing.
